What is the Warranty Deed From Husband And Wife To A Trust New York

A warranty deed from husband and wife to a trust in New York is a legal document that transfers property ownership from a married couple to a trust. This type of deed provides a guarantee that the property is free from any liens or encumbrances, except those specifically stated in the deed. It is commonly used in estate planning to ensure that assets are managed according to the grantors' wishes during their lifetime and after their passing. By transferring property to a trust, the couple can facilitate smoother management and distribution of their assets.

Key Elements of the Warranty Deed From Husband And Wife To A Trust New York

Several essential components make up a warranty deed from husband and wife to a trust in New York. These elements include:

  • Grantors: The names of the husband and wife transferring the property.
  • Grantee: The name of the trust receiving the property.
  • Legal Description: A detailed description of the property being transferred, including boundaries and location.
  • Consideration: The value exchanged for the property, which may be nominal in a transfer to a trust.
  • Signatures: The signatures of both grantors, along with a notary public's acknowledgment, to validate the deed.

Steps to Complete the Warranty Deed From Husband And Wife To A Trust New York

Completing a warranty deed from husband and wife to a trust involves several steps to ensure legality and accuracy. Follow these steps:

  1. Gather necessary information about the property, including its legal description.
  2. Draft the warranty deed, ensuring all required elements are included.
  3. Both spouses must sign the deed in the presence of a notary public.
  4. File the completed deed with the appropriate county clerk's office to make the transfer official.
  5. Keep a copy of the filed deed for personal records.

Legal Use of the Warranty Deed From Husband And Wife To A Trust New York

The legal use of a warranty deed from husband and wife to a trust in New York is primarily for estate planning purposes. This deed ensures that the property is managed according to the terms of the trust, providing benefits such as avoiding probate and maintaining privacy regarding asset distribution. Additionally, it protects the grantors by guaranteeing that the property is free from claims, thus ensuring the trust can operate without legal hindrances.

State-Specific Rules for the Warranty Deed From Husband And Wife To A Trust New York

In New York, specific rules govern the execution and filing of a warranty deed from husband and wife to a trust. These rules include:

  • The deed must be signed by both spouses.
  • A notary public must witness the signatures for the deed to be valid.
  • The legal description of the property must adhere to state standards.
  • The deed must be filed with the county clerk's office where the property is located.
  • Any applicable transfer taxes must be paid at the time of filing.
